- English Word Broker Definition One who transacts business for another; an agent.
- English Word Broker Definition An agent employed to effect bargains and contracts, as a middleman or negotiator, between other persons, for a compensation commonly called brokerage. He takes no possession, as broker, of the subject matter of the negotiation. He generally contracts in the names of those who employ him, and not in his own.
- English Word Broker Definition A dealer in money, notes, bills of exchange, etc.
- English Word Broker Definition A dealer in secondhand goods.
- English Word Broker Definition A pimp or procurer.
- English Word Brokerage Definition The business or employment of a broker.
- English Word Brokerage Definition The fee, reward, or commission, given or changed for transacting business as a broker.
